Issue/Introduction
AD-RMS no working properly. There are 7 main places to check for RMS functionality
Resolution
- Verify you can reach the following pipeline URLs from an AD RMS client computer:
- Enterprise publishing: http(s)://<adrms_cluster_name>/_wmcs/licensing/license.asmx
- Enterprise certification: http(s)://<adrms_cluster_name>/_wmcs/certification/certification.asmx
- Make sure the email address of the client user is configured in Active Directory. Check using either:
- Active Directory Users and Computers Console
- Active Directory Administrative Center
- Make sure the SCP for AD RMS does not have the port specified within the Address specified for it
- Verify that when using SSL the certificate is trusted by the AD RMS client
- Check that the DRM cache is cleared of any failed installation or configuration changes:
- you can remove %localAppdata%\Microsoft\DRM directory contents and let them be reacquired by the client.
- Check that there are not multiple .GIC or .CLC files installed on the AD RMS client
- Check the directory %localAppdata%\Microsoft\DRM for multiples of these files
-
Verify that the IIS application pool is started
- Go into IIS and expand to the application pools. Make sure the ones running RMS and RW applications are started
